Cultivating Sustained Focus and Attentional Control
Maintaining concentration over prolonged elimination brackets is one of the steepest challenges a modern competitor faces. High-pressure environments naturally trigger stress responses that can easily fracture an athlete's attention span. To combat this cognitive fatigue, successful players implement systematic breathing protocols and focus exclusively on manageable performance metrics rather than the final scoreboard.
Sustained focus also enables elite competitors to accurately read table dynamics and track opponent distributions in real time. By training the mind to filter out crowd noise and superficial variables, individuals preserve the cognitive stamina required for late-stage adjustments. This level of discipline ensures that strategic integrity remains intact even during volatile pacing shifts.
Navigating High-Stakes Decisions Under Pressure
The final phases of any major tournament bring immense psychological tension that tests emotional stability. Impulsive choices driven by immediate pressure often lead to catastrophic tactical errors and premature elimination from the bracket. Successful performers rely on calculated probability models and professional judgment rather than emotional reactions to guide their wagering or positioning.
Clarity under pressure ultimately separates seasoned champions from casual event participants. By embracing the unpredictability of tournament formats and relying on deep situational awareness, players make mathematically precise choices when their rivals succumb to anxiety.
